my car is having an intermitten problem I cant figure out...
I returned my fuel system back near stock to try and eliminate possibilities... right now I am using stock injectors, vortech regulator, crane hi6 ignition, and crane ps92 coil...
ok.. my car has a bad missfire problem in vacuum... makes it nearly undrivable in vacuum, runs good under boost (maybee a miss now and then)... sometimes it will run just fine...
I dont know what could cause an intermitten problem like that.. the plug wires are NGK's that arent too old, but I put a big thick fuel line on all of them to eliminate the possibility of them leaking a spark, I changed the ignition rotor, the cap is a little old, but it looks good (msd), the fuel filter only has 20K on it, the fuel pressure is about 32 psi at idle under vacuum, ~40 psi at no vacuum, and about 150 under boost, I changed the sparkplugs and gapped them to 30, this has happened with different gas tanks, so it shouldnt be bad gas... my car was running like a champ and then all of the sudden started running bad...
I guess it could be bad distributer (although the tach doesnt seem to jump) a bad ignition box, a bad coil...
I need help! what do you guys think? any ideas?
